My Keller Williams Story

Before pursuing this career as a Realtor I spent several years negotiating union contracts and defending grievances as an officer for a local union. Before that I was a bartender. I was always interested in real estate, but I didn't really know how to get into it. A friend of mine was going to real estate school, so I decided it was time.  I figured with my customer service and negotiating background I would make a good Realtor.

It was tough getting started in real estate. Even after going to real estate school I had no real idea what I was getting into. I thought you could just start working for a company and they would provide you with clients... Not So! You have to find your own clients. It's not easy, you know it - you are starting your own business.
